This document summarizes a presentation given by Muhd Shahrulmiza Zakaria, a Trade Commissioner from MATRADE New York, to the Greenville Chamber of Commerce on doing business with Malaysia. The presentation outlines that MATRADE promotes Malaysian enterprises globally and facilitates sourcing from Malaysia. It then describes Malaysia as an ideal sourcing destination for various products and industries due to its strengths like price competitiveness, quality, resources, and business friendliness. Finally, it provides statistics on the growing bilateral trade between Malaysia and the US.
